SIP phone administration on Session Manager
Avaya J100 Series IP Phones might display a prompt asking for the extension and password
during the administration on Avaya Aura
®
Session Manager. The phones use the extension and
password to communicate with Session Manager, which communicates with Avaya Aura
®
Communication Manager.
